INFORMATION BULLETIN (02-84) October 1, 2002 Sustainable Fisheries Division 3:15 p.m. 907-586-7228 NMFS ANNOUNCES 2003 R&R WORKSHOP SCHEDULE The National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S), Alaska Region, and the United States Coast Guard, North Pacific Regional Fisheries Training Center (USCG) will present workshops for the fishing industry on 2003 recordkeeping and reporting (R&R) requirements for fisheries of the exclusive economic zone off Alaska, according to James W. Balsiger, Administrator, Alaska Region, NMFS. Regulations implementing R&R requirements are found at 50 CFR part 679. The workshops will present groundfish and Individual Fishing Quota (IFQ) R&R requirements along with instructions for completion and submittal of the required forms and logsheets, including new electronic submittal options. Suggestions, questions, and feedback from participants on new and existing procedures and regulations are welcome.
